How they compare

Uganda currently reports 0.0805 kt against 0.0785 kt in Estonia, a difference of 0.002 kt.

The two have swapped places 1 time across 34 shared years of data; in 1992 it was Estonia ahead.

Estonia ranks 115th and Uganda ranks 114th of 199 countries.

Across the 6 decades both report, Estonia averaged higher in 5 and Uganda in 1.

The FAOSTAT domain on Emissions from Crops provides estimates of emissions associated with crop processes, namely 1) crop residues, 2) burning of crop residues, and 3) rice cultivation and the application of nitrogen (N) fertilizers, including mineral and chemical fertilizers, to soils. Estimates are computed at Tier 1 following the 2006 IPCC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 2006).
